What is remote telemetry monitoring?

A Remote Telemetry Monitoring job involves overseeing and analyzing data from patients, machines, or systems remotely using telemetry technology. In healthcare, this typically includes monitoring patients’ vital signs and alerting medical staff to critical changes. In other industries, such as energy or telecommunications, it involves tracking equipment performance and detecting faults in real time. The role requires strong analytical skills, attention to detail, and proficiency with monitoring software. It ensures the safety, efficiency, and optimal functioning of the monitored subjects.

What does a typical day look like for someone working in remote telemetry monitoring?

A typical day in Remote Telemetry Monitoring involves continuously observing patient data streams, analyzing vital signs for irregularities, and promptly alerting clinical teams to any significant changes. You’ll spend much of your time using specialized software to monitor multiple patients, documenting findings, and collaborating remotely with on-site nurses and physicians. The role requires high concentration and the ability to prioritize tasks efficiently within a team-based or independent work environment. While it can be fast-paced, this position offers the rewarding challenge of making a direct impact on patient care from a remote location.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in remote telemetry monitoring?

To excel in Remote Telemetry Monitoring, strong analytical abilities, attention to detail, and a background in healthcare or allied health fields are typically required. Familiarity with telemetry software, remote patient monitoring systems, and relevant certifications such as Basic Life Support (BLS) or Certified Telemetry Technician are highly valued. Excellent communication skills, critical thinking, and the ability to work independently make candidates stand out in this position. These skills are essential for accurately interpreting data, promptly identifying abnormalities, and ensuring patient safety in a remote setting.
